Transaction 20608df959f8abb9cb243614374777cfebfbe2bd62c087a0db1c0fbf19503fd6
1 Input
1 Output
-
20608df959f8abb9cb243614374777cfebfbe2bd62c087a0db1c0fbf19503fd6:0
- value
- 69000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 de888c7f9dc70d23af23b74218b00c4d09885f27 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MHebAZZnbajsCL6yJX9aRcQXEHUmCMMKZ